Einzelnen Beitrag anzeigen

endeffects

Registriert seit: 27. Jun 2004
450 Beiträge
 
#6

Re: FileStream.Size ist negativ (Datei größer als 2GB)

  Alt 19. Mär 2005, 19:33
hallo,

das problem wird durch die abfrage von filestream.size erzeugt,
der wert ist ja nunmal leider nur ein longint.

Delphi-Quellcode:
SrcStream:=TFileStream.Create(FileName,fmOpenread or fmShareDenyNone);
N:=SrcStream.Size;
  while N>0 do
    ...
im fall von N<0 multipliziere ich den wert momentan einfach mit -1,
ich vermute allerdings dass das so nicht ganz richtig ist *g
  Mit Zitat antworten Zitat